Paisley was begging for a second glass after she slurped down the first in a matter of 2 minutes. I used frozen berries instead of fresh. If you use frozen, you'll want to defrost them in the microwave for about 20 seconds first.
Ingredients:
1/2 cup blackberries
1/2 cup raspberries
1/2 cup mashed cooked cauliflower
1/2 cup cooked broccoli
1/2 cup milk
Cinnamon for garnish
Directions:
Cook the broccoli and cauliflower until it's soft enough to mash, toss into the blender, and puree on high for 1 minute.
Add berries and milk, blend on high for 2 minutes. Pour into a glass, and sprinkle cinnamon on top. Serve immediately. (Makes about 2 servings)
